Conventional vehicle definition

Conventional vehicle means a vehicle, as defined by Section 502.001, Transportation Code, that is exclusively powered by gasoline or diesel fuel.
Conventional vehicle means any self-propelled, motorized vehicle designed for transporting persons or property on a public highway and must be registered.
